Reinstalling Windows

If your computer is not working correctly, try the following options to correct
the problem:
Troubleshooting. For more information, see "Troubleshooting" on
page 219.
Reinstalling device drivers. For more information, see "Reinstalling device
drivers" on page 199.
If the options above do not correct the problem, you can use the Restoration
CDs to reinstall Windows and other software.
The Restoration CDs step you through reinstalling Windows XP. If you are
reinstalling Windows XP, the Restoration CDs automatically reinstall the
hardware device drivers and some programs as well. You can install any
remaining programs by using the program CDs that came with your computer.
To reinstall your programs, follow the instructions in "Reinstalling programs"
on page 203.

To reinstall Windows XP and the device drivers:
Warning
1
Insert the red Gateway CD into the CD, DVD, or recordable drive.
2
Restart your computer.
3
Select
2. Boot from CD-ROM
4
Select a language option.
5
Select
1. Delete all files (Automated Fdisk/Format)
If you are prompted for your Windows product key when
you reinstall Windows, you can find the key on the
Microsoft Certificate of Authenticity label located on the
bottom of your computer case. For more information, see
"Microsoft Certificate of Authenticity" on page 12.
Back up your personal files before you use this option.
All files on your computer will be deleted!
